    Sábado 26:

    COLOMBIA-ECUADOR (en España) 2:0
    Goles de Guarín y F.García.

    Portugal-CHILE 1:1
    Gol de Fernández.

    Estados Unidos-ARGENTINA 1:1
    Gol de Cambiasso.

    Méjico-PARAGUAY (en Estados Unidos) 3:1
    Gol de Riveros.

    Domingo 27:

    Escocia-BRASIL (en Inglaterra) 0:2
    Goles de A.Santos y Neymar.
